Thompson at [email protected]” followed by two paragraphs, “About the Jawbone of a Pike Kantele photo on the cover: This kantele was made by the grand old man of Finnish kantele, Martti Pokela, who was born in Haapavesi. Pokela donated this kantele (and many others) to the city of Haapavesi. The Pokela collection can be viewed in the City Hall lobby and in the coffee shop at the technology village. According to Jane Ilmola, director of traditional kantele and music educator in the Haapavesi school systems, scholars have found information that gives reasonable doubt as to whether the stories of the first kantelle in the Kalevala really originated in Karelia or in the province of Oulu since many of the families of runesingers who sang the songs that Lönnrot wrote down migrated to Karelia from the Oulu province.” and “About the Kantele Photo on the Title Page: American kantele maker Gerry Henkel has his own ‘jawbone of a pike’, kantele inspired by the Kalevala story of the wizard, Väinämöinen. Henkel is the major supplier of kanteles and jouhikkos to people in North America and has made over 1,500 instruments.
